Ubisoft Trademark Ghost Recon Future Soldier

Posted By | On 20th, Dec. 2009

If a filed trademark by USPTO is anything to go by, it seems that Ubisoft is trademarking a character for a future game.

 

No other information is available, except that it is related to a video game (duh!). However, the statement suggests a multiplatformer:

Class Status: Active

Game software and electronic game programs, namely software games recorded on CD-ROM and digital video discs for computers; software games recorded on CD-ROMs, digital video discs, and cartridges for console and individual, portable gaming systems; software games that are downloadable from a remote computer site and electronic game software for mobile phones, personal digital assistants, and handheld computers.”

Future Soldier latest addition to Ghost Recon franchise?

The trademark was filed on Monday.
